Brazil launches US$3 billion scheme for power companies amid pandemic
Credit: shutterstock.com/alex rodrigo brondani
Mattos Filho, Veiga Filho, Marrey Jr e Quiroga Advogados has helped Brazil’s Chamber of Electric Energy Commercialisation (CCEE) obtain 15 billion Brazilian reais (US$3 billion) in financing from a syndicate of banks to launch a financial support scheme for Brazil’s electricity sector amid the covid-19 crisis.
